CVE-2019-15048: Buffer Overflow
Published Aug 14, 2019
·Updated
An issue was discovered in Bento4 1.5.1.0. There is a heap-based buffer overflow in the AP4RtpAtom class at Core/Ap4RtpAtom.cpp.
